Project Analyst - Commercial & Specialized Industries - Analyst
You are customer focused, enjoy developing talent and managing programs. A role as a Project Analyst for Middle Market Banking and Specialized Industries is for you.
As a Project Analyst within the Middle Market Banking Program Team, you will focus on developing talent in banking, underwriting and treasury fundamentals. You will report into the National Program Director and will assist in managing the execution of early talent programming for both Analyst and Associate populations, as well as provide support to Business Managers in day-to-day program management responsibilities and engagement. Collaborating with specialists in Human Resources, Finance and Business Management, and Business Operations are also instrumental to you successfully delivering this program.
Job Responsibilities
- Assist the Program Management team across all program-related tasks, including but not limited to onboarding, recruiting, training, rotation process, and post-program placement process
- Attend & facilitate meetings and program sessions as needed, take strong notes and drive follow-ups for the team
- Provide daily, tactical support of the projects and workstreams for the C&SI Analyst Program
- Maintain program roadmap and calendar of events
- Interface with business representatives from across the Commercial Bank; Coordinate events /sessions logistics which may include traveling to program locations

Required Qualifications, Capabilities and Skills
- 1 plus years relevant experience post-college graduation; experience in a program/project management role, Human Resources, or recruiting is a plus
- Completed BA/BS degree (all majors considered)
- Expertise with Microsoft Office suite, particularly Excel and PowerPoint. Data fluency is a plus.
- Strong analytical, leadership, interpersonal and written/verbal communication skills
- Proven ability to multi-task and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
- Accuracy and attention to detail is critical
- Exhibit sound judgement, agility, and the ability to work as a team player; Ability to travel to various office locations
Preferred Qualifications, Capabilities and Skills
- Experience within Commercial Banking
- Embrace a culture of respect, diversity and inclusion

ABOUT THE TEAM
J.P. Morgan's Global Banking business is one of the largest wholesale banking client franchises in the world. We serve clients, including corporations, governments, states, municipalities, healthcare organizations, education institutions, banks and investors.
Commercial Banking provides credit and financing, treasury and payment services, international banking and real estate services to clients-including corporations, municipalities, institutions, real estate investors and owners, and not-for-profit organizations.
